"Govt lying about deaths at Maha Kumbh," alleges Akhilesh Yadav

Samajwadi Party (SP) President Akhilesh Yadav on Sunday launched a sharp attack on the Uttar Pradesh government over the alleged mishandling of the Maha Kumbh Mela, accusing it of failing to account for missing devotees and misleading the public about casualties.

Lucknow (Uttar Pradesh) [India], March 23 (ANI): Samajwadi Party (SP) President Akhilesh Yadav on Sunday launched a sharp attack on the Uttar Pradesh government alleging mishandling of the Maha Kumbh Mela and accusing it of failing to account for missing devotees and misleading the public about casualties.
Speaking to media after an event, Akhilesh Yadav said, "...In a holy event like Maha Kumbh, the government neither wants to compensate the devotees who have died or are missing nor does it want to find them... The path of truth and religion is Sanatan, but they (the state government) are lying about the death or missing of devotees... It was propagated that this was a digital Maha Kumbh. If it was so, then where did the drones and CCTV go from there (in the Maha Kumbh Mela area)?"
Meanwhile, Uttar Pradesh Chief Minister Yogi Adityanath expressed gratitude to Prime Minister Narendra Modi for implementing the Namami Gange project successfully, saying that the success of Mahakumbh 2025 validates the initiative's impact.
He said that the program has restored the continuous and pure flow of the Ganga River, allowing aquatic life to thrive once again.
The Namami Gange program, launched in 2014, aims to reduce pollution and rejuvenate the Ganga.
Under this initiative, significant improvements have been observed in Uttar Pradesh.
"With Namami Gange, the PM has once again offered a clean Ganga to the nation. The Ganga Action Plan came into effect in 1996, but by 2014, Ganga had become more polluted. Pollution levels reached an extent that aquatic life was destroyed. But now, the success of Mahakumbh validates the success of Namami Gange. Aquatic life has revived in Ganga; dolphins can be seen. This shows our respect for our heritage," said CM Yogi while participating in a special program at the Bithoor Mahotsav in Kanpur.
Earlier, PM Modi also commended the successful organisation of the Maha Kumbh in Prayagraj, attributing its success to the dedication of the public, administration, and devotees across the country and highlighting the collective efforts that contributed to the grand event. (ANI)
